Google Pixel 4 XL’s wifi is disconnected due to GPS location

If you notice that your Google Pixel 4 XL’s wifi connects and disconnects itself quite often, we perhaps know what’s causing it. Indeed, in the event you discover this on your phone, it’s perhaps the parameter: IMPROVING PRECISION is activated. The latter is a parameter that is utilized to improve your geolocation utilizing the wifi networks that your Google Pixel 4 XL meets. It occurs sometimes that the Google Pixel 4 XL connects and disconnects itself. To find out if this is the circumstance or if you desire to disable this option, go to Parameters then Localization then Mode and finally High precision . When the option is off, the trouble should be solved and you should see the battery life boosted.

Google Pixel 4 XL’s wifi is disconnected due to an application

If the wifi of your Google Pixel 4 XL is disconnected, it’s possible that it’s thanks to an application. Indeed, it may happen that an application comes into conflict with the wifi network Google Pixel 4 XL. To find out if this is the cause of the problem, we advise you to uninstall the applications that have been installed since the trouble occurred.

The problem originates from the intelligent wifi of the Google Pixel 4 XL

There exists on a few telephone like the Google Pixel 4 XL an option that is called INTELLIGENT WIFI. This option aims to always connect to the wireless network that captures the best. Nonetheless, when this option is activated, the Google Pixel 4 XL may then connect and disconnect quite often. You only need to move or two networks at a similar distance for the phenomenon to occur. Thus, if you want to turn off this option, you need to go to: Settings> Wifi> Advanced Settings> Smart Network.

The wifi is disconnected after a Google Pixel 4 XL update

If your Wi-Fi disconnection concerns occur after updating your Google Pixel 4 XL, it’s likely the trouble will originate from there. If this is the circumstance for you, we advise you to reset your Google Pixel 4 XL after saving the data.
